The same dream
came late last night
I looked at my hand and
it was twelve
I looked again
and it was dawn
I was delicate steel
hard and cold as diamond
light as the gray ash
that flies for miles long after
the fire is gone
I saw it touch the clouds
saw it brush the hills with
orange watercolor,
felt a distant warmth
on my ironclad back
and I let go, collapsed
on the face of that mountain
and I slept
for a long while
until the light receded
and I awoke in the dark.
